The first step to filing an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ney for an assessment of your case at no cost. Your lawyer will help determine which corporations are responsible for your case and what type of claim is best. Asbestos exposure can take many forms which makes it difficult for asbestos-related victims to recall exactly when or where they were exposed. However, mesothelioma attorneys have access to databases that contain thousands of companies, products, and job locations where asbestos exposure occurred.

Asbestos lawyers are also able to look into the specifics of a case to find evidence that supports your claims. You may have medical records that show that you were diagnosed with mesothelioma, or a death certifcate that states "mesothelioma". Asbestos lawyers are familiar with how to request these documents and what questions to ask in order to get the most of them.

A seasoned mesothelioma attorney will understand the laws of each state that affect the how you file your case. In New York, for example you have to file your lawsuit within the state if the business which exposed you to asbestos is located in that. Attorneys from nationwide firms will have experience filing claims across multiple states and know the law in each state.

Mesothelioma, a life-threatening and painful condition that affects the linings of the lungs. The cause is asbestos exposure that has been utilized in residential and commercial building products for more than 30 years. The exposure could be experienced in a variety of different ways, including at work, in schools, in the military and at home.

Anyone diagnosed mesothelioma is able to make a claim for personal injury against the company which exposed them to asbestos lawsuits. They can also file a wrongful-death claim on behalf of a loved one who has passed away from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related illnesses.

Asbestos sufferers can receive financial compensation for expenses like lost wages, medical expenses and costs for treatment. Asbestos lawyers can assist their clients get these damages back through filing a mesothelioma lawsuit or a trust fund claim against companies that are responsible for asbestos exposure. They can also assist clients in filing a w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f of a loved one who has died from m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can determine whether a patient is entitled to a claim for compensation and help them with filing a lawsuit or trust fund VA claim. The value of each mesothelioma claim is unique and determined by multiple factors that include the patient's asbestos exposure, age at diagnosis, as well as the amount they have lost due to the disease. Compensation may include past and future medical expenses, lost wages, the loss of a loved one legal fees, punitive damage as well as discomfort and pain.
